Wired Communication: The Unseen Backbone

Amidst the chaos of artillery barrages and gas attacks, the most reliable form of communication remained stubbornly low-tech. Soldiers unspooled thousands of miles of copper wire, laying intricate networks that connected front-line trenches to rear-area headquarters. Although susceptible to being cut by shellfire or enemy raiders, the physical cable provided a secure and fast conduit for voice and telegraph traffic. This infrastructure, often defended by pioneer units working under constant fire, formed the literal backbone of the war effort, ensuring that orders could flow down and reports could flow up without delay.

The Advent of Wireless Telegraphy

The introduction of wireless radio revolutionized command and control, particularly for units operating in fluid environments like the skies and the seas. Aircraft, initially used for reconnaissance, required a way to relay intelligence back to commanders without relying on vulnerable ground units. Naval fleets, spread across vast oceans, used wireless signals to maintain cohesion and project power. However, this new freedom came with a critical trade-off: every transmission was a beacon, broadcasting the sender's location and intentions to anyone with the technical capability to intercept and decipher the traffic. The Human Element: Operators and Cryptographers Technology alone did not win the communication war; the individuals who operated the machines and protected the information were just as vital. Young men, often recruited for their technical aptitude, found themselves thrust into the cacophony of war, listening for the hum of generators or the crackle of static. Behind the front lines, a different kind of battle emerged as cryptographers from Britain, France, and the United States worked tirelessly to break the coded messages that protected enemy plans. The interception and decryption of German diplomatic communications, notably the Zimmermann Telegram, provided a stark illustration of how information security could shift the geopolitical balance.

Strategic Deception and the Fog of War

With the ability to listen in on enemy communications came the opportunity to manipulate and deceive. Commanders understood that not every signal needed to be genuine, creating an environment of paranoia and uncertainty. Fake radio traffic could simulate the existence of entire armies, misleading opponents about the location and timing of major offensives. This "fog of war" was intentionally amplified by disinformation, where false radio messages sowed discord and confusion within the ranks of the enemy, eroding morale and trust in leadership long before troops clashed.
